Understanding General Kroger Hours
Generally, most Kroger stores operate with extended hours to accommodate a variety of shopping schedules. This commitment to customer convenience is a hallmark of Kroger's service. Standard Kroger hours typically fall within the range of 7:00 AM to 10:00 PM, seven days a week. However, these are just general guidelines. The specific hours can vary based on several factors, including the store's location, the day of the week, and even local demand. For instance, a Kroger store in a busy urban area might have slightly extended hours compared to one in a more suburban or rural setting. Similarly, weekend hours might differ from weekday hours to cater to the increased weekend shopping traffic. It's also important to remember that some Kroger stores may have special hours for certain departments, such as the pharmacy or the deli. These departments might open later or close earlier than the main store. Therefore, it's crucial to verify the exact hours for your local Kroger to avoid any surprises. Kroger Holiday Hours: What to Expect
Navigating Kroger holiday hours requires a bit of extra planning, as store schedules often vary on major holidays. While Kroger aims to serve its customers as much as possible, most stores do adjust their hours on holidays to allow employees to spend time with their families. Generally, Kroger stores are closed on Christmas Day. This is the most consistent holiday closure across all locations. However, hours may be reduced on other holidays, such as Thanksgiving, Easter, and New Year's Day. On these days, stores may open later than usual or close earlier. It's also common for Kroger to have special holiday hours on Christmas Eve and New Year's Eve, often closing earlier than their regular hours.
